Olympic champions Wang Chuqin and Sun Yingsha defeated South Korea's Lim Jong-hoon and Shin Yu-bin in straight sets to advance into the mixed doubles final at the World Table Tennis Championships on Friday.
The second seeds dominated the game throughout and won 12-10, 11-6, 16-14 over 34 minutes.
Wang and Sun, seeking their third straight mixed doubles crown, will take on 16th-seeded Japanese pair Maharu Yoshimura and Satsuki Odo, who reached the final with a 3-1 (11-8, 11-1, 4-11, 11-2) victory over third seeds Wong Chun Ting and Doo Hoi Kem.
"It will be a great moment for us when we compete with the top players in the world," said Yoshimura.
